Blackstone Inc. (NYSE: BX) generates frequent news coverage as the world’s largest alternative asset manager, and its announcements highlight activity across real estate, private equity, credit, infrastructure and energy-related investments. This news page aggregates updates drawn from Blackstone’s own releases and regulatory disclosures so readers can follow how the firm deploys capital and manages its portfolio.
Recent items illustrate the breadth of Blackstone’s activity. Funds managed by Blackstone’s private equity strategy for individual investors became the sole institutional investor in AIR Control Concepts, a commercial HVAC, electrical and controls platform operating across numerous U.S. states and Canada. Blackstone Energy Transition Partners and other Blackstone funds acquired Alliance Technical Group, an environmental testing, monitoring and compliance services provider, and announced a majority ownership position in a combined MacLean Power Systems and Power Grid Components platform serving the electrical grid.
Other news features include Blackstone Energy Transition Partners’ investment in Wolf Summit Energy, a combined-cycle natural gas power generation facility in West Virginia, as well as a strategic partnership with Phoenix Financial focused on corporate, real estate and asset-based credit. Blackstone Credit & Insurance has also announced a forward flow origination partnership with Harvest Commercial Capital to acquire small business loans secured by first lien mortgages on owner-occupied commercial real estate.
In addition, Blackstone issues updates on capital markets activity, such as senior notes offerings by an indirect financing subsidiary, and appearances at financial conferences. Blackstone has appointed Emily Yoder as Senior Managing Director of Strategic Relationship Management. This newly created role positions her as a key liaison with Blackstone's banking and financial service partners. Yoder, who previously served at JPMorgan, is expected to enhance relationships with these partners as Blackstone continues its rapid expansion across various sectors. Vik Sawhney, a senior executive at Blackstone, expressed confidence in Yoder’s capabilities to strengthen these crucial relationships.
Blackstone Life Sciences (BXLS) announced the hiring of Dr. Monika Vnuk and Matt Lane as Managing Directors in Cambridge. Dr. Vnuk, previously with Pfizer, brings extensive experience in worldwide business development, notably in the COVID-19 vaccine partnership with BioNTech. Matt Lane has over 20 years in life sciences advising, including significant tenure at Cowen Group. BXLS currently manages over $7 billion in assets and aims to leverage the new hires' expertise to enhance investment activities in biopharmaceuticals.

Simpli.fi has received a significant equity investment from private equity funds managed by Blackstone, valuing the company at approximately $1.5 billion. This partnership with GTCR positions Blackstone and GTCR as majority shareholders. Simpli.fi, which powers over 120,000 digital campaigns each month for 30,000 active advertisers, aims to enhance its product innovation and market leadership in programmatic advertising. The goal is to adapt to the growing shift from linear to digital media spending.
Blackstone LaunchPad expands its student entrepreneurship program to the College of Southern Nevada and University of Nevada, Las Vegas. This initiative aims to equip students with essential entrepreneurial skills and opportunities to foster next-generation companies and careers. Key benefits include access to a global network, mentorship, pitch competitions, and fellowships. The expansion aligns with Blackstone Charitable Foundation’s $40 million commitment to support diverse higher education institutions, ultimately benefiting economic recovery in Nevada.

Blackstone Mortgage Trust (NYSE:BXMT) announced a private offering of $400 million in aggregate principal amount of its 3.750% senior secured notes due 2027. The offering closes on October 5, 2021, and the Notes will be guaranteed by wholly owned subsidiaries. This private transaction is aimed at qualified institutional buyers under Regulation S and Rule 144A of the Securities Act. The Notes have not been registered under the Securities Act, and their resale is subject to applicable laws.

Blackstone (NYSE: BX) announced its portfolio company Transmission Developers Inc. has been selected by NYSERDA to deliver 1,250 MW of clean power to New York City. The Champlain Hudson Power Express project, spanning 339 miles, aims to significantly reduce fossil fuel reliance and carbon emissions, creating 1,400 jobs and establishing a $40 million Green Economy Fund for job training. The project is anticipated to start delivering power in 2025, subject to contract negotiation and necessary approvals.
